From California Penal Code, 490.5:
when an adult or emancipated minor has unlawfully taken merchandise from a merchant's premises, the adult or emancipated minor shall be liable to the merchant for damages of not less than fifty dollars ($50.00) nor more than five hundred dollars ($500.00), in addition to the retail value of the merchandise, if not recovered in undamaged condition, plus costs. An action for recovery of damages, pursuant to this subdivision, may be brought in small claims court if the total damages do not exceed the jurisdictional limit of such court, or in any other appropriate court. The provisions of this subdivision are in addition to other civil remedies and do not limit merchants or other persons to elect to pursue other civil remedies.
